What is a Legal Notice?
A legal notice is a document sent by one party to another, either directly or through an advocate, to communicate their intention to undertake legal proceedings against the recipient. It serves as a formal warning and provides an opportunity for the recipient to settle the matter before it escalates to court.
When Should You Send a Legal Notice?
Legal notices are typically sent in the following situations:
Non-payment of dues or cheque bounce cases
Property disputes and encroachment issues
Breach of contract or agreement
Defamation cases
Consumer complaints
Employment and salary disputes
Key Components of a Legal Notice
A well-drafted legal notice should contain the following elements:
Details of the sender: Name, address, and contact information
Details of the recipient: Complete name and address
Facts of the case: Clear and chronological description of events
Legal basis: Applicable laws and provisions
Relief sought: Specific demands and timeline
Consequences: Action to be taken if demands are not met

How to Send a Legal Notice?
Legal notices should be sent through registered post with acknowledgment due or through a reliable courier service. This ensures you have proof of delivery, which is crucial for court proceedings.
- Steps to Send a Legal Notice:
Draft the notice with all required details
Get it reviewed by a qualified advocate
Send it via RPAD or courier
Keep a copy for your records
Wait for the response (usually 15-30 days)
